As Second in Department, you will be a key architect of our Religious Studies curriculum, ensuring it remains academically rigorous and deeply relevant. You will work within an ambitious team at Kingsdown, where your leadership will directly remove barriers to learning and improve the life chances of our young people.

Professional Agency: We trust you as the expert in your domain. We provide the autonomy for you to lead in your context without micromanagement.

Leadership Training: We don't just hire leaders; we build them. You will have access to bespoke leadership training and pathways to support your career progression.

Workload-Sensitive Culture: We focus on what is genuinely impactful for pupils. This means prioritising effective feedback over performative marking and protecting your time for high-quality CPLD.

Proven Impact: A track record of delivering excellent outcomes for students in Religious Studies.

Curriculum Expertise: A creative and well-researched approach to RS, with the ability to develop and refine high-quality schemes of work.

Leadership Potential: The resilience to tackle challenges head-on and the desire to mentor and develop colleagues.

Evidence-Informed Mindset: A commitment to using professional research to improve classroom practice.
